Postseason ends for Irmo Little League

By Thomas Grant Jr.

The summer runs for Irmo Little League softball and baseball ended this past weekend.

The Southeast Region champions finished 2-3 at the Senior League Softball World Series played in Sussex County, Deleware. They went 1-3 in Pool B play, the lone victory taking place against the Europe-Africa Region by a 4-3 score.

Trailing 2-1 in the Bottom 6th, Kate Shealy of Batesburg-Leesville tied the game with an RBI fielder’s choice. She and Savanna Padgett of Pelion both scored off an error on a groundball hit by Malia Lewis of Irmo.

After Europe-Africa got within a run, Shealy retired the final two batters for the complete game win. She also had a sole home run.

Following a 12-6 loss to the West Region, Southeast (Irmo) faced Southwest in a Purple consolation game. A trio of players accounted for three home runs in the 12-1 rout in five innings.

Melinda Veler of White Knoll went 2-4 with four RBI. She and Padgett, who went 3-4 along with Shealy who had a solo home run, both had 3-run homers.

Katherine Goff picked three innings and struck out two for the victory.

The Irmo Little League team began its quest to return to the Little League World Series last Thursday in Warner Robbins, Georgia. They opened the Southeast Regional with a 4-1 win over West Virginia after scoring three runs in the Bottom 6th.

An 8-1 loss to Florida Friday knocked Irmo Little League into the loser’s bracket. They rebounded Saturday with a 5-0 win over Virginia and were a victory away from playing for a spot in the Southeast Regional final for the second straight year.

Instead, Irmo Little League’s season ended with a 6-1 loss to Tennessee. The Tennessee/Florida winner faced Alabama Tuesday in the final.
